In React Native, there are several popular libraries for using icons in your application. Here are some of the most commonly used icon libraries:


1. React Native Vector Icons

  • Description: The most popular and comprehensive icon library for React Native, featuring a wide range of icons from different icon sets.
  • Icon Packs: FontAwesome, Ionicons, MaterialIcons, Feather, and many more.

  • Installation:

npm install react-native-vector-icons
Copy after login
Copy after login
  • Usage:
import Icon from 'react-native-vector-icons/Ionicons';

<Icon name="home" size={30} color="#900" />
Copy after login
Copy after login
